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Кижка студентам _іформатика друк.doc
Скачиваний:
18
Добавлен:
05.12.2018
Размер:
5.76 Mб
Скачать

Типи полів та їх властивості

У системі Access, як і в інших базах даних, рядок таблиці ототожнюється з терміном “запис”, а колонка - з терміном “поле”. Кожне поле має своє ім’я, тип і властивості .При створенні структури таблиці обов’язково вказують імена і типи полів. Властивості можуть прийматися по замовчуванню. Одне або кілька полів необхідно визначити як ключові.

В Access використовують такі типи полів :

  • текстове - містить літери, цифри, інші символи. Його властивості:

розмір поля - від 1 до 255 символів,

формат поля - вигляд та розмір полів, який задається такими кодовими символами: @–текстовий символ або пропуск, & - текстовий символ, < - перетворення символів у нижній регістр, > - у верхній регістр.

маска вводу - задає тип символу (цифра, літера, пропуск) у кожній позиції вводу з допомогою таких символів: 0 - цифра від 0 до 9, 9- цифра чи пропуск, # - цифра, пропуск, плюс або мінус, L- буква від A до Z або від А до Я,& - будь-який символ, .,:;- роздільники і т.д.

підпис - друге ім’я поля,

умова на значення - задає фільтр, який забезпечує введення у дане поле тільки тих значень, які відповідають заданій умові,

обов’язкове поле - “так” або “ні”(так - дані поля повинні відповідати властивостям поля),

пусті стрічки - “так” або “ні” (дозволені чи ні пусті стрічки),

індексоване поле - “так “ або “ні”

  • числове поле – яке має такі властивості:

байт - цілі числа в межах від 0 до 255;

ціле - цілі числа від -32768 до 32767;

довге ціле - цілі числа від -2147483648 до 2147483647;

з плаваючою крапкою (4 байт) - числа в межах від -3,402823 Е38 до 3,402823 Е38;

з плаваючою крапкою (8 байт) – числа в межах від -1,79769313486232 Е308 до 1,79769313486232 Е308;

дійсні числа – всі дійсні числа.

  • поле дата/час має такі ж властивості, як і у текстового поля. Формат може бути таким:

повний формат дати – наприклад, 12.05.07 15:20:21

довгий формат дати – наприклад, 23 січня 2008р.

середній формат дати – наприклад, 12-сер-07р.

короткий формат дати – наприклад, 01.12.07

довгий формат часу – наприклад, 12:00:23

середній формат часу – наприклад, 03:21 РМ,

короткий формат часу – наприклад, 12:23.

  • логічне поле, яке використовується в анкетних даних і набирає значень “так “ або “ні”, “істина” або “хиба”;

  • лічильник – використовується для лічби записів;

  • грошовий – використовується для фінансових даних;

  • поле типу MЕМО, яке містить текст, числа довжиною до 64000 символів;

  • поле об’єкта OLE, яке містить інформацію про посилання на ім’я об’єкту.

Створення бази даних

На початковому етапі роботи з базами даних, доцільно підготувати структури таблиць бази даних. У структурі таблиці слід чітко визначити назви полів, які дані будуть в цьому полі і т.д.

Для створення бази даних відкриваємо Access і у вікні запрошення встановлюємо перемикач у положення "Новая база данных", потім натискаємо кнопку Ok. Появиться вікно Файл нової бази даних, у якому вказуємо ім’я файлу бази даних.

Відкриється вікно бази даних. У ньому перераховані такі способи створення таблиць: створення в режимі конструктора, створення з допомогою майстра таблиці, створення шляхом введення даних. Створивши структуру таблиці, її відкривають для заповнення даних.

Кожна таблиця бази даних повинна містити одне або декілька полів, які ідентифікують кожен запис в таблиці. Вони допоможуть швидко віднайти і зв’язати між собою дані із різних таблиць з допомогою запитів, форм і звітів. Це поле називається ключовим. Якщо для таблиці позначені ключові поля, то Access запобігає дублюванню або вводу порожніх значень в ключові поля. Отже, у ключовому полі не може бути повторів.

Найбільш простим є вибір ключовим полем поля типу лічильник. Якщо в таблиці такого поля не має, то при закритті структури таблиці, програма запропонує автоматично створення ключового поля лічильник.

Якщо таблиці містить поле, яке має унікальні значення, які не повторюються, то його можна зробити ключовим.

У випадках, коли гарантувати унікальність кожного поля не можливо, існує можливість створити ключ з декількох полів. Таке трапляється, коли таблиці пов'язані між собою зв’язком.

Для створення ключового поля, його слід виділити і викликати у контекстному меню пункт "Ключевое поле".

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]